Understanding violation severity
Tier 1Urgent health risk. Utility must notify all customers within 24 hours.Tier 2Important health or treatment issue. Customers notified within 30 days.Tier 3Administrative or monitoring issue. Reported in the annual water quality report.

Frequently Asked Questions About C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M
Is C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M water safe to drink?
C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M water receives a grade of B (71/100), which is considered good. Out of 38 contaminants tested, 2 exceed EPA legal limits. 2 contaminant(s) exceed non-enforceable health goals. The water meets federal safety standards.
What contaminants has C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M detected?
38 contaminants were tested in C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M's water. Notable contaminants include PFOS, PFOA. 2 exceed EPA legal limits (MCLs). 2 exceed EPA health goals (MCLGs).
Does C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M have any EPA violations?
Yes, C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M has 5 EPA violation(s) on record, with the most recent in 2022. Violation types include MCL, MR, Other. 2 are health-based violations.
How many people does C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M serve?
C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M serves approximately 4,516 people, North Carolina. The system provides water to 1 community: Sanford.
What type of water does C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M provide?
CAROLINA TRACE WATER SYSTEM sources its water from purchased surface water. Surface water comes from rivers, lakes, or reservoirs and typically requires more extensive treatment. The utility's system ID is NC0353101.
